Smart Climate Sensors
Smart climate sensing units have actually reinvented the efficiency of modern-day irrigation systems by readjusting sprinkling schedules based on real-time ecological data. These sensing units keep track of variables such as temperature, moisture, wind rate, and solar radiation, permitting systems to react dynamically to altering weather problems. By incorporating this information, smart sensors can enhance water usage, reducing waste and guaranteeing that landscapes obtain the proper quantity of wetness. This technology not only saves water yet likewise promotes healthier plant growth by avoiding overwatering or underwatering. In addition, the automation offered by clever climate sensing units boosts user comfort, as landscaping companies and homeowners can count on accurate watering timetables without manual treatment. On the whole, these innovations stand for a considerable improvement in lasting irrigation techniques.

Soil Moisture Sensors
Dirt moisture sensing units play a crucial role in modern irrigation systems, supplying real-time information that boosts water effectiveness. These tools measure the volumetric water material in the soil, permitting accurate assessments of wetness levels. By incorporating dirt wetness sensing units right into irrigation systems, users can avoid overwatering or underwatering, eventually advertising healthier plant development and conserving water resources.The sensing units transfer information to controllers, which can change sprinkling routines based upon existing soil problems. This data-driven approach lessens water waste and warranties that plants receive the ideal amount of wetness. Furthermore, soil wetness sensing units can be valuable in different agricultural settings, from home yards to large farms. The release of these sensors contributes to lasting techniques by sustaining accountable water usage and minimizing environmental impact. On the whole, the consolidation of dirt dampness sensors notes a substantial development in achieving effective watering systems.

What Is the Life-span of Modern Sprinkler System Elements?
The life expectancy of modern-day automatic sprinkler components usually ranges from 5 to 20 years, relying on the materials made use of, maintenance techniques, and ecological conditions. Regular upkeep can substantially boost durability and efficiency gradually.
